Week 4: Create a Writing Habit

Hi and welcome to week 4! This week we’ll be talking about writing.

Having a writing habit in place is your most powerful ally in academic life. The idea of sitting down daily and having our work progress, bit by bit, perhaps not quite automatically, but smoothly, consistently, it’s appealing isn’t it? There is a confidence that springs from consistently moving forward. How do we get to that place where our work flows? We’ll be finding out this week.

We start with my absolute favourite tool of the course: ‘Allow Your PhD to Write Itself’, which is a writing process I developed when I was writing my own PhD. If you pick one thing to work on this week (or at all) I would pick this one.

We’ll also be discussing everything that comes between you and your writing flow – writer’s block be gone! Lowering your expectations really helps.

We finish the week by asking how to make writing a habit, something we do (almost) automatically, not something we have to use all our willpower for to muster the courage.

There are times when our writing slows and it may seem impossible it will ever (ever!) pick up speed again. Let’s put those times in the past.

Good luck this week, and let’s write!
